Adebayor Signs Long-term Deal With Arsenal
Emmanuel Adebayor has signed a new contract with Arsenal, putting an end to a long summer of speculation linking the striker with a move away from the Emirates. The Togo international, who scored 30 goals last season, had, at one stage, looked to be on his way out of Arsenal with AC Milan and Barcelona likely destinations.
The 24-year-old, who arrived from Monaco in January 2006, put an end to the speculation when he pledged his future to Arsenal earlier this month, and has now backed up that statement by signing a long-term deal, believed to be for four years.
"Arsenal can today confirm that Emmanuel Adebayor has signed a new long-term contract with the club," read a club statement. "Everyone at Arsenal looks forward to Emmanuel's continued contribution to the club over the coming years."
